SQL Reporting Server Requirements

  • Enable the .NET Framework 3.5 by using the Add Roles and Features Wizard. For details, see https://technet.microsoft.com/en-in/library/dn482071.aspx
  • If SSL is enabled on the Report server, verify that the certificate name in the Issued To field is seen in the URL when accessing reports as follows:
    • Enter the fully qualified domain name (FQDN) of the IIS server into the Common name field. Internet Explorer compares the certificate common name to the server name specified in the URL when accessing a web site over a Secure Sockets Layer (SSL) connection. If the certificate common name and the server name in the URL do not match, Internet Explorer displays a certificate warning error message.
  • For SQL server versions 2008 R2, 2012 and 2014, the default collation setting on the ReportServer/ ReportServerTempDB databases is 'Latin1_General_CI_AS_KS_WS'. This is supported and must not be changed.
  • For SQL version 2016, the default collation setting on the ReportServer/ ReportServerTempDB databases is 'Latin1_General_100_CI_AS_KS_WS'.
  • For SQL version 2017 and 2019, the default collation setting on the ReportServer/ ReportServerTempDB databases is 'Latin1_General_100_CI_AS_KS_WS'.
